abstract class SyncIOBuilderOps[T[_[_]]] extends AnyRef
Builder step that allows to choose between sequential and parallel execution and specify the effect type.

def
parallel[F[_]](parallelism: Int)(implicit arg0: Async[F]): T[F]
Creates a builder for parallel execution.
Creates a builder for parallel execution.
This builder creates instances with the specified level of parallelism.
-
def
parallel[F[_]](implicit arg0: Async[F]): T[F]
Creates a builder for parallel execution.
Creates a builder for parallel execution.
This builder creates instances with a level of parallelism matching the available cores. For explicit control of parallelism use the other
parallel
method. -
def
sequential[F[_]](implicit arg0: Sync[F]): T[F]
Creates a builder for sequential execution.
